The study of fixed stars dates back to the earliest civilizations, with Babylonian, Egyptian, and Greek astrologers all attributing great importance to them. These ancient cultures observed the night sky with unparalleled dedication, noting the subtle shifts and patterns that dictated seasons, agricultural cycles, and even the perceived destinies of kings and empires. Ptolemy, in his monumental work, the Almagest, cataloged many of these stars and their associated influences, laying a foundation for future astrological study.

Key Fixed Stars and Their Astrological Meanings

While there are hundreds of fixed stars recognized in astrological traditions, certain prominent ones are frequently referenced due to their perceived power and influence. The "Astrology King" constellation of stars often includes those that are particularly bright, easily visible, and have strong historical associations. Let's explore some of these luminous guides:

1. Aldebaran (Alpha Tauri)

Located in the eye of Taurus, Aldebaran is a brilliant red giant star, one of the brightest in the night sky. It is considered a star of great fortune, often associated with honor, ambition, and success. When Aldebaran strongly aspects a planet, particularly in the conjunction, it can bestow great courage, determination, and the potential for leadership. However, it also carries a warning: pride and arrogance can lead to downfall.

  • Keywords: Ambition, courage, honor, success, leadership, potential for pride.

2. Sirius (Alpha Canis Majoris)

Known as the "Dog Star," Sirius is the brightest star in the night sky and holds immense significance in many ancient cultures. It is associated with fame, fortune, and loyalty. Sirius can bring great public recognition and success, but it also carries the potential for extremism and the need for spiritual grounding. Its influence is often described as a double-edged sword, capable of bestowing immense blessings or profound challenges.

  • Keywords: Fame, fortune, loyalty, public recognition, spiritual awareness, potential for extremism.

3. Regulus (Alpha Leonis)

Regulus, the "Heart of the Lion," is a bright star at the center of Leo. It is traditionally associated with royalty, power, and success. When Regulus conjoins a planet, it can bring great honor, leadership, and the ability to influence others. However, like Aldebaran, it warns against vanity and a lust for power, which can lead to ruin.

  • Keywords: Royalty, power, success, leadership, influence, honor, warning against vanity.

4. Antares (Alpha Scorpii)

Located in the heart of the Scorpion, Antares is a brilliant red star, often seen as the rival to Aldebaran. It is associated with courage, determination, and the ability to overcome adversity. Antares can bestow great bravery and resilience, but it also carries the potential for ruthlessness and a combative spirit.

  • Keywords: Courage, determination, resilience, combativeness, overcoming adversity, potential for ruthlessness.

5. Spica (Alpha Virginis)

Spica, the "Ear of Wheat" in Virgo, is a brilliant blue-white star. It is traditionally associated with artistic talent, intellectual pursuits, and good fortune. Spica can bring success in creative endeavors, academic achievements, and a refined appreciation for beauty and harmony.

  • Keywords: Artistic talent, intellectual pursuits, good fortune, beauty, harmony, creativity.

6. Vega (Alpha Lyrae)

Vega, a bright blue star in the constellation Lyra, is associated with creativity, inspiration, and idealism. It can bring artistic talent, a love of beauty, and a desire for spiritual growth. However, Vega can also indicate a tendency towards escapism or a disconnect from reality.

  • Keywords: Creativity, inspiration, idealism, artistic talent, spiritual growth, potential for escapism.

How Fixed Stars Interact with Your Natal Chart

The true power of fixed star astrology lies in understanding how these celestial influences interact with the planets and points in your natal chart. The most significant interactions occur when a planet or a sensitive point (like the Ascendant, Midheaven, or Lunar Nodes) forms a close conjunction (within a degree or two) to a fixed star.

Conjunctions: The Amplification Effect

When a planet conjoins a fixed star, the star's energy is directly infused into the planet's expression. For example:

  • Sun conjunct Aldebaran: This can indicate a person with immense drive, ambition, and the potential for great leadership and public recognition, but also the risk of becoming overly proud or arrogant.
  • Moon conjunct Sirius: This might suggest a person with a deep capacity for loyalty and a strong connection to the public, potentially leading to fame or a significant role in their community, but also a need for emotional balance.
  • Mercury conjunct Spica: This often points to a sharp intellect, creative thinking, and a talent for communication, particularly in artistic or academic fields.
  • Venus conjunct Regulus: This can bring charm, social grace, and a natural ability to attract admiration and success, often in positions of influence or leadership in social circles.
  • Mars conjunct Antares: This imbues Mars with immense courage, combativeness, and the drive to overcome any obstacle, but can also lead to aggressive tendencies if not managed.

Modern Interpretation of Ancient Royal Stars

In contemporary astrology, the "royal stars" of Persia – Aldebaran, Regulus, Antares, and Fomalhaut – are often highlighted for their significant impact. These stars, forming a cross in the sky, were believed to have protective or governing qualities.

  • Aldebaran: The watcher of the East, associated with courage and honor.
  • Regulus: The watcher of the North, associated with leadership and success.
  • Antares: The watcher of the West, associated with courage and combativeness.
  • Fomalhaut: The watcher of the South, associated with creativity, artistic talent, and sometimes melancholy or isolation.

When these stars are prominent in your chart, particularly conjuncting your Sun, Moon, Ascendant, or Midheaven, they can indicate a person destined for significant influence or a life marked by profound experiences. Finding Fixed Stars in Your Chart

To explore the fixed stars in your own astrological chart, you will need a detailed natal chart calculated by a professional astrologer or an advanced astrological software program. Many modern charting programs allow you to input fixed star data and will automatically highlight conjunctions.

When you receive your chart, look for any planets or sensitive points that are within 1-2 degrees of a known fixed star. The exact degree of the conjunction is important, as is the nature of the star itself and the planet it is conjuncting.

It’s also worth noting that different astrologers may use slightly different degrees for fixed star conjunctions, as the stars themselves move very slowly over thousands of years (a phenomenon known as precession of the equinoxes). However, the core meanings and influences remain consistent.
